BCO 34.4
Book of Church Order (PCA)
34.4. 33-4
33-4. When it is impracticable immediately to commence process against an accused church member, the Session may, if it thinks the edification of the Church requires it, prevent the accused from approaching the Lord’s Table until the charges against him can be examined, but this requires a two-thirds (2/3) majority.
